// New teammates: this constant sets the minimum contrast ratio (4.5:1)
// enforced across the Bramblewick design system. It comes directly from
// our accessibility audit last quarter, which found several muted-gray
// labels failing on the Heathfield theme. Lowering it requires sign-off
// from the audit working group. The audited reference build is recorded
// by the token below.

pipeline stamp: htk9_ce63042d9

### Checklist: Tax-rate lookup cache warm-up — Quillbook

Before flipping traffic, warm the Quillbook tax-rate cache or the first wave of checkout calls will hammer the Ledgerline upstream. Run the warmer job against all active regions, then spot-check a few jurisdictions in the admin panel — stale rates are the classic on-call page at 2am. TTL should read 6h, not the old 30m default. Once the warmer finishes clean, grab the build token it prints and paste it here.

pipeline stamp: htk3_69f

Plugin authors extending Carverline should understand how the farm schedules work before adjusting anything. Each worker claims a segment lease, transcodes it under a wall-clock budget, and surrenders the lease if the budget expires, so plugins that add filters must stay within the per-segment allowance or segments will be retried elsewhere and billed twice. Concurrency, lease duration, and retry backoff are all centrally configured; plugins may read these values but must never override them. The current defaults are as follows.

tuning table, fawip-fahag:
WEIGHTS = {
    "novwyn": 452,
    "casdor": 675,
}